CVE-2024-39381: After Effects | Out-of-bounds Write (CWE-787)
After Effects versions 23.6.6, 24.5 and earlier are affected by an out-of-bounds write vulnerability that could result in arbitrary code execution in the context of the current user.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must open a malicious file.

How do I fix CVE-2024-39381?
To address CVE-2024-39381, update Adobe After Effects to version 23.6.9 or later, or versions 24.6 or later.
